For the 2025 school year, there are 3 private elementary schools serving 246 students in Havana, FL.
The top ranked private elementary school in Havana, FL is Tallavana Christian School.
The average acceptance rate is 60%, which is lower than the Florida private elementary school average acceptance rate of 83%.
100% of private elementary schools in Havana, FL are religiously affiliated (most commonly Christian).
